Taking audiences back to 1980, this hilarious musical follows the beautiful Kira, who travels to earth to inspire a struggling young artist named Sonny. Farrar was also responsible for most of the hits that were performed by Olivia Newton-John in the 1970s. Lynne wrote and produced all of the music of Electric Light Orchestra (E.L.O). The score, by Jeff Lynne and John Farrar, includes the hits, “Magic,” “Xanadu,” “All Over the World” and “I’m Alive” - all top 20 Billboard hits. Performances will take place as part of 3Below Theaters’ “Up On The Roof” program, an outdoor entertainment festival taking place on the roof of the 2nd Street and San Carlos Garage above 3Below Theaters.ĭouglas Carter Beane penned the book for XANADU based on the film of the same name. XANADU, the musical hit that enchanted South Bay audiences for 11 weeks in 2011 at The Retro Dome, returns for a limited run at San Jose Playhouse.
